dovecot-2.0: ostream-buffer: Don't grow buffer above max_buffer_...
dovecot at dovecot.org
dovecot at dovecot.org
Wed Aug 12 00:00:01 EEST 2009
details: http://hg.dovecot.org/dovecot-2.0/rev/7c0b29275651
changeset: 9766:7c0b29275651
user: Timo Sirainen <tss at iki.fi>
date: Tue Aug 11 16:59:55 2009 -0400
description:
ostream-buffer: Don't grow buffer above max_buffer_size.
diffstat:
1 file changed, 1 insertion(+), 1 deletion(-)
src/lib/ostream-buffer.c | 2 +-
diffs (12 lines):
diff -r 935b9cfc1905 -r 7c0b29275651 src/lib/ostream-buffer.c
--- a/src/lib/ostream-buffer.c Tue Aug 11 14:08:09 2009 -0400
+++ b/src/lib/ostream-buffer.c Tue Aug 11 16:59:55 2009 -0400
@@ -70,7 +70,7 @@ o_stream_buffer_sendv(struct ostream_pri
left = bstream->max_buffer_size - stream->ostream.offset;
n = I_MIN(left, iov[i].iov_len);
buffer_write(bstream->buf, stream->ostream.offset,
- iov[i].iov_base, iov[i].iov_len);
+ iov[i].iov_base, n);
ret += n;
if (n != iov[i].iov_len)
break;
More information about the dovecot-cvs
mailing list